Up until now, Rhino had 6 home variations with a transparent header design appeared at the first impression. Today’s update brings a new solid header from the very beginning. However, you’ll still get the same old solid header design when scrolling down.
To get the solid header design from the beginning, go to your Joomla backend > Menus. Open the Page Display tab in the editing mode, and put 'solid-header' inside the Page Class field. Save changes, and it's done!
